Re-Writing Our Climate's Future by Embracing Creativity and Optimism In-Person

Presented in partnership with Yale Planetary Solutions

Join us for a short reading by science fiction author and journalist Annalee Newitzfollowed by a panel discussion about what it will take to create a thriving, sustainable future, and pathways for technology and creativity that can combine to make that vision a reality. This event will conclude the first edition of the Yale Planetary Solutions Sci X Sci-Fi series. The event is free and open to the public.

Panelists:

Dawn Ragsdale (Executive Director of the Center for Inclusive Growth)

Julie Zimmerman (Yale’s Vice Provost for Planetary Solutions)

Science fiction author and journalist Annalee Newitz

About Sci X Sci-Fi

The week-long Sci X Sci-Fi series, presented by Yale Planetary Solutions, runs from March 31 to April 3 with Annalee and other guest speakers, including New York Times writer Carl Zimmer and author Coco Ma, is designed to inspire thriving, positive futures.
